Transaction 103d8319ef73b3278c87e8d6dc5c988ed09410dc88388c1d95a7c26e0ef23571
1 Input
1 Output
-
103d8319ef73b3278c87e8d6dc5c988ed09410dc88388c1d95a7c26e0ef23571:0
- value
- 1347629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ea1930926be063e84a1cfca347991a6353316f8 OP_EQUAL
- address
- 34UykgWAKhFrwGG1Sa9Gn9F9xZYUAgbYzq